D-Day Dodgers - Written by Alan Hebden. Art by Vicente Alcazar. Cover by Ian Kennedy. In 1944, someone named the servicemen in Italy the D-Day Dodgers; as though somehow the war they were fighting was a cushy number compared to the battles in France. Outraged, one national newspaper decided to expose these loafers once and for all. That's how reporter Perry Potter and his photographer Chalky White came to be standing on a freezing airfield in "sunny" Italy. The weather was just the first of the eye-openers the pair was going to see. Weekly British War comics digest. Softcover, 5 1/2-in. x 6 1/2-in., 68 pages, B&W.
